Where do pour the power steering fluid in at a 1997 Chevy silverado?

The power steering fluid reservoir on a 1997 Chevy Silverado is usually located on the driver's side of the engine compartment. It's often a small, cylindrical reservoir with a cap that might be marked with a power steering symbol (a steering wheel often with an arrow) or the words "Power Steering Fluid".

However, there's no single definitive location. The exact placement can vary slightly depending on the engine size and specific trim level.

To locate it:

1. Consult your owner's manual: This is the best source of information. It will have a diagram showing the location of all fluids.

2. Look closely at the driver's side of the engine bay: Search for a small reservoir, possibly plastic, with a cap, and check for markings.

3. Use an online parts diagram: Many auto parts websites (like AutoZone, Advance Auto Parts, etc.) allow you to select your specific year, make, model, and engine, then view a diagram of the engine compartment. This can help you visually pinpoint the reservoir.

Important Note: Before adding any fluid, check the fluid level first. Overfilling can be just as harmful as underfilling. The reservoir usually has minimum and maximum fill lines.
